    Medicine Description

    Androxin tablets are an important medication used in the treatment of androgen-dependent prostate cancer. These tablets contain the active ingredient flutamide at a concentration of 250 mg. Flutamide belongs to a class of medications called nonsteroidal antiandrogens. This medication provides targeted hormonal therapy that helps control disease progression and improve patient outcomes.

    Androxin uses:

    Androxin tablets are used in the treatment of:

    Advanced prostate cancer: as a combination therapy with luteinizing hormone-releasing hormone (LHRH) agonists or after surgical orchiectomy.

    Treatment of primary flares caused by LHRH agonists: LHRH agonists can cause an initial increase in testosterone levels, which may lead to a temporary worsening of prostate cancer symptoms.

    The goal of treatment is to stop the growth of cancer cells in the prostate, relieve symptoms associated with the disease, and control its progression.

    What is the dosage of Androxin?

    Androxin tablets should be taken as directed by a specialist physician. The dosage and duration of treatment are determined precisely by the oncologist.

    The usual adult dosage is one 250 mg tablet three times daily (i.e., 750 mg daily).

    The medication can be taken with or without food.

    Swallow the tablet whole with a glass of water.

    When used with LHRH agonists, the tablets should be started at least 3 days before starting treatment with the LHRH agonist to prevent primary flares. This medication is a long-term treatment. You must adhere to the prescribed dosage and duration of treatment, and not stop taking the medication suddenly without consulting your doctor.

    What are the side effects of Androxin?

    Androxin tablets may cause some side effects, which are usually related to its hormonal effects:

    Hot flashes.

    Loss of libido or impotence.

    Breast enlargement (gynecomastia) or breast pain.

    N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ea (especially at the beginning of treatment).

    Changes in liver function: Elevated liver enzymes, which may lead to serious liver damage (rare but possible).

    Fatigue.

    Changes in appetite or weight.

    You should inform your doctor immediately if you experience any severe, persistent, or unusual side effects, especially any signs of liver problems (such as yellowing of the skin or eyes, dark urine, severe abdominal pain), or shortness of breath.
